Transaction 75e18144848fdd6f63aa63334977145fa160c18ed5a2f9898cb07dbc91390541
1 Input
1 Output
-
75e18144848fdd6f63aa63334977145fa160c18ed5a2f9898cb07dbc91390541:0
- value
- 548206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 635fc37b2c17b54dae700797f2bf96504f74dc80 OP_EQUAL
- address
- 3AkTYJj3N7D6yw8fd3gX69qWn7b3jL4ECk